Reminder: Check your android TV for ON/OFF functionality every once in awhile.

TL/DR: 2017 Sony's can turn on/off with Google Assistant now.

So I've had a 2017 Sony Android Tv for awhile now and the Google Assistant's On and Off would never work. Matter of fact, I almost bought a Chromecast Ultra at one point, mainly just to turn on the TV, but realized it wasn't worth the hassle.

Well, last night while I was lamenting maybe buying a Samsung TV as my new living room TV, as I like how I can turn it off remotely via it's app.. I just half jokingly asked my Pixel phone's Google Assistant to turn on my Sony TV (like I had a million times before).... and the TV turned on! Startled, I asked it to turn it off, and it went off. Dazed and confused at what I just witnessed.. I decided to try to turn it on again.. and it came on! At this point, I was picking my jaw up off the floor... as a dream had come true for me (Maybe a Christmas miracle?). Anyway, what never worked before, suddenly works. Don't know if it was just me, or everyone.

So.. it seems an update happened at some point that allows this to work and I just didn't notice. Hence the reminder. You may be surprised to find out what didn't work before.. suddenly works today. Always worth the attempt. I came very close to making a buying decision I would have probably regretted, had I not checked again.
